Across Europe, the appeal of biochar continues to strengthen as the region prioritizes long-term soil regeneration and sustainable agricultural output. Farmers who once relied heavily on synthetic additives are shifting toward carbon-rich natural amendments that deliver higher soil productivity without degrading the environment. Biochar’s porous structure helps maintain root moisture, enhance microbial activity, and stabilize nutrients, making it an ideal solution for regions experiencing soil fatigue. As climate conditions fluctuate more frequently, the demand for resilient soil solutions has become more urgent, driving continuous interest.

The increasing awareness of carbon-removal strategies has positioned the Europe Biochar Market as a major contributor to Europe’s sustainability transition. Countries such as Germany, the UK, France, and the Nordics are evaluating large-scale adoption programs linked to agricultural sustainability, waste-to-value initiatives, and emission-offset pathways. Environmental agencies and research centers are studying how biochar can integrate with regenerative farming models that reduce fertilizer dependency. Its ability to store carbon for hundreds of years reinforces its relevance as climate-neutral farming becomes a cornerstone of the region’s agricultural evolution.

In the industrial sector, applications are expanding rapidly. Biochar-based filtration systems, livestock feed additives, green construction materials, and advanced composites are gaining traction. Waste management authorities are embracing pyrolysis technologies to convert agricultural biomass and organic waste into high-value carbon materials. As recycling standards and circular-economy goals rise, these innovations create stable revenue streams while supporting environmental objectives. The integration of biochar into construction materials is particularly noteworthy, as it offers thermal insulation, humidity regulation, and long-term carbon storage.
